WebAn Gorta Mor, The Great Famine, [1845-1850] caused by the total failure of the potato crop was the most cataclysmic event in modern Irish history. A million people died of starvation and famine related disease and a million plus were forced to emigrate, many of them died on board the ‘Coffin Ships’ bearing them to the land of promise.In the ...
